Can a bunny have mustache?

Rabbits don't have mustaches in the same way that humans do. They don't have the upper lip hair that we associate with mustaches.

However, rabbits do have vibrissae, which are long, sensitive hairs around their nose, mouth, and eyes. These vibrissae act as sensory organs, helping them navigate and explore their environment.

So, while bunnies don't have mustaches in the traditional sense, their vibrissae might be considered a form of facial hair, giving them a unique and endearing look.
